Upgrade fails on external SSD

I'm trying to get 10.15 installed on an external SSD. I started by using recovery mode to install Mojave on it from a MacBook Pro. That all worked fine. I then booted into the new installation and downloaded the beta. The installer runs for a while and gets to the point where it asks to restart. When I click the restart button, some apps close, but then it says "An error occurred while preparing the installation." I can't find any logs or details on why exactly it's failing.


Has anyone gotten the beta working on an external drive?

Some times this is caused by the date/time not being correct. Boot into recovery, go to utilities > terminal. To verify what the current date and time is type "date" if the date or time is wrong, try correcting it. The command to adjust date/time: "date mmddHHMMyyyy." If this is not the issue or you are still facing the problem after try reset the NVRAM or PRAM.


Shut down your Mac, then turn it on and immediately press and hold these four keys together: Option, Command, P, and R. You can release the keys after about 20 seconds, during which your Mac might appear to restart.
